What I Look for in Rod Action
One of the first things I check is the rod action. I pay attention to whether the rod is slow, medium, or fast action because that changes how the rod bends and responds. For me, a slower action fiberglass rod often feels more traditional and flexible, while a medium action gives me a nice middle ground for control and casting ease. I choose based on how I plan to fish and how much sensitivity I want.
Why Rod Power Matters to Me
Rod power tells me how much weight and pressure the rod can handle. When I shop for a 10 ft fiberglass rod, I always think about the type of fish I expect to catch. If I want something for lighter fish, I lean toward lighter power. If I need more backbone, I look for medium or heavier power. Matching the rod power to my target fish helps me avoid frustration and improves my overall experience.
My Thoughts on Handle Comfort
I never ignore the handle because comfort matters a lot during long fishing sessions. I prefer a grip that feels secure in my hand and does not slip easily when wet. In my experience, cork and EVA foam are both common options, and each has its own feel. I usually choose the one that feels most natural to me, especially since a 10-foot rod can be used for extended periods.
What I Check About Build Quality
Before I buy, I look closely at the overall build quality. I want a rod that feels solid without being too heavy. I inspect the guides, reel seat, and blank finish because those details often tell me how well the rod is made. A well-built fiberglass rod usually gives me more confidence and lasts longer, which is important if I plan to use it regularly.
How I Think About Weight and Balance
Since a 10 ft rod is longer than many standard rods, I always pay attention to weight and balance. If the rod feels too heavy, I know it may tire me out quickly. I prefer a rod that balances well in my hands so I can cast and retrieve more comfortably. For me, good balance makes a big difference in control and reduces fatigue.
